衣康酸接枝PP增容PA6/PP合金的研究

摘    要:以马来酸酐接枝PP(MPP)作对照,研究了衣康酸接枝PP(IPP)的熔体流动速率(MFR)、接枝率(GR)妆枝配方的关系,PA6/接枝PP/PP合金的力学性能与接枝PP的特征参数、用量和合金组成比的关系。结果表明,IPP对PA6/PP的增容效率明显高于MPP,并具有显著提高材料冲击韧性的作用,可作为PA/PP高效增容剂兼增韧剂应用。

Study on PA6/PP Alloy Compatibilized by Itaconic Acid Grafted PP

Abstract:By contrast with maleic anhydride grafted PP (MPP),relationships between melt flow rates(MFR) and grafting ratios (GR) of the itaconic acid grafted PP (g_PP)and its graft formula and relationships between mechanical properties of PA6/g_PP/PP alloy and feature parameter and doses of g_PP and ratios of PA6/(PP g-PP) are studied. Results show that the compatibilizing efficiency of IPP to PA6/PP is much higher than that of MPP and IPP can evidently enhance the impact toughness of the alloy,it can be used as the compatibilizer and impact modifier for PA/PP alloy.
